Outreach Ministries

Our mission is to be a liaison between Unity North Church and our local community, helping in ways that align with Unity principles.

Here are the services in which we are involved. Some are ongoing and others are seasonal. Our ongoing services are:

  • Family Table Meal – This is a meal we put on once a month that is free to the community. We are part of a network of churches that provide dinners for people in our community.
  • Unity’s Food Shelf – We collect specific food off a list from our community. This food fills two boxes that will feed a family of four for one week. We also provide a $25 gas card and Cub card for extra fresh food items, such as milk and bread, to supplement the food boxes.
  • Fare for All – This is a community food bank for fresh foods. We buy shares with our community volunteer hours to obtain fresh fruits and vegetables. These shares contain fresh meat, fruit and vegetables that we distribute to community members as requested.
  • Teddy Bears – We collect Teddy Bears for our Family Sunday Bear Blessing Service. After the service we deliver the bears to Unity Hospital geriatric unit and an Anoka County agency that gives a bear to a child in crisis.

Here are some of the seasonal projects that we do:

  • Head Start Book Drive – (May-June) Head Start is a preschool child development program. Head Start focuses on the child’s physical, intellectual, emotional and social development, while providing advocacy assistance to parents. We collect money to buy a book for Head Start graduates ready to start Kindergarten.
  • Back to School Supply Drive – (August) We collect school supplies for CEAP (Community Emergency Assistance Program). This is a popular program for those of us who miss buying those backpacks, pencils and rulers. There are other opportunities to volunteer for this program such as collecting supplies at Northtown Mall and stuffing backpacks. For more information see www.ceap.org.
  • Adopt-A-Family Christmas – (November-December) We “adopt” a number of families through Everyday Miracles and buy the whole family Christmas gifts. This is a very popular church-wide event. www.everyday-miracles.org


FAMILY PROMISE:

Family Promise of Anoka County provides temporary shelter for families who are experiencing homelessness. For one week per quarter, Unity North Church provides that shelter. We provide an evening meal, fellowship, a place to sleep, and a simple breakfast in the morning.

Families arrive on Sunday evening. They settle in and have some dinner. The kids do homework or watch a movie. Everyone has a safe, warm place to sleep. Families are kept together. In the morning, after breakfast, Family Promise sends a van to pick up the families. Some go to work, some go to school, some search for employment or work on barriers to permanent housing. In the evening, they come back to the church and do it all over again.

Four times per year, we offer this critical service to our friends and neighbors in Anoka County. Unity North Church feels blessed to be of service.
